Another season of the very successful “Celebrity Duets” on GMA-7 begins Friday night and it promises to be more exciting, what with the diverse celebrities chosen as participants.

To watch out for are the performances of actor/producer Jomari Yllana, former beauty queen Janina San Miguel, costume and fashion designer to the stars Max Cinco, beauty maven Mikaela Bilbao, “lord of scents” Joel Cruz, award-winning actress and director Gina Alajar, top Brazilian-Japanese model Akihiro Sato, topnotch fashion photographer Niccolo Cosme, and WBA Interim Super Flyweight World Champion Nonito Donaire, Jr. One of them will take over the championship title held by “Celebrity Duets 2” winner MMDA Chairman Bayani Fernando.

Of course, every one of them wants to win. Every one of them believes he has what it takes to be the Season 3 winner. But every one of them admitted during the press conference held at Annabel’s that they are not singers. That is our common denominator, “we are not really singers,” Jomari said. Asked who he would like to do duets with, the actor/producer said “sana sina Aiko (Melendez), Ara (Mina) and Pops (Fernandez) pero di ko masabi sa kanila, nahihiya ako eh.” Of course we all know that these were the three women in Jomari’s past love life.

Actress-director Gina Alajar, like Jomari, is in the contest because she couldn’t say no to Ms. Redjie A. Magno. “I asked myself, tama ba ito? But I couldn’t say no to Redgie.” She will do her best, she said although singing is not her forte. She enjoyed their taping and she also said she realized that singers undergo much pressure, have to work hard – “I don’t know how they do it.” But she has an edge over her competitors. “I am a Best Actress,” she laughed. Who she wants to do duets with? “Sana sina Andrea Boccelli, Celine Dion and Barbra Streisand pero busy daw sila,” she said in jest. If she wins though, part of her winning will be given to animal societies because her children love animals.

Janina San Miguel said she would like to sing with Michael V., Jamie Rivera (she likes her Christian songs) and Jay-R. If she wins, she’ll share her prize with special children because “charity begins at home. I have a brother who is a special child.”

Mikaela Bilbao said being in the contest is a big challenge “because I don’t sing at all. But all of us know that singing takes away the stress, so it’s a refreshing stint for me. Everything happens with a reason or purpose so if I win, every cent will go to charity…” She’d like to sing with Janno Gibbs, Jaya and Rhada.

Nonito Donaire, Jr. who said he could have been a singer if he did not become a boxer, likes to duet with Gary Valenciano and Martin Nievera and his winning will be used for the completion of a church.

Joel Cruz of Aficionado Germany Perfumes said he’s happy to be part of “Celebrity Duets Season 3” although he’s not a singer like the rest. But he is successful in business and he’s dreaming now to be successful also in this contest “that’s why I’ve already texted my friends to support me,” he laughed. When asked why he joined “Celebrity Duets Season 3,” Joel said “walang dahilan na hindi ko tanggapin ang offer. Because if I win, I will donate my prize money to the 10 charitable organizations that I’ve been supporting all these years: Hospicio de San Jose, Tahanang Walang Hagdanan, Asilo de San Vicente de Paul, Pediatrics No. 9 and 11 of PGH, Missionaries of Charity, Kids Foundation, Jesus Loves the Little Children, Mother Theresa-Sisters of Charities Foundation in Tayuman, “Wish Ko Lang” of GMA-7, and a sampaguita girl vendor in Quiapo.

“Celebrity Duets Season 3” is hosted anew by singer-songwriter Ogie Alcasid and Asia’s Songbird Regine Velasquez. Back in the judges’ table are veteran concert and theatre director Freddie Santos, renowned composer and arranger Danny Tan and socialite and “Celebrity Duets Season 1” winner Tessa Prieto-Valdes.

The much-awaited premiere of “Celebrity Duets Season 3” airs Friday night, after “Wish Ko Lang,” GMA-7.

The ‘Power Boys’ at Metrobar

Sam Milby and Richard Poon get to share the stage via a concert billed as “Power Boys,” slated at the Metrobar (West Ave., Quezon City) Friday night (Aug. 29).

Produced by Front Desk Entertainment Production, “Power Boys” has for special guests two young ladies – stars in their own right – Danita Paner and Ynna Asistio, plus the very special participation of wacky comedian Chokoleit. It also features belter Camille Bangoy.

“It’s fun to be with Richard in a show. We would only see each other during ‘ASAP 09’ but we don’t get the chance to be on the same stage during concerts. We have the same business manager but we don’t get to perform together. This time, it would be more fun because magkaiba kami ng style of singing ni Richard though I have to admit that I am also a big fan of Richard’s music,” said Sam who is super-busy with so many shows, teleseryes and movies.

“Sam is a good friend. Undoubtedly, he has so many fans. He’s a very big star. He’s been very supportive of me since the day I started singing professionally. Now, I can’t imagine singing on the same stage with him. Well, I guess I’ve prepared enough para mapansin din naman ako (laughs). We have different types of music kaya for sure, walang sapawang mangyayari sa aming dalawa,” Richard humbly said.
